General Manufacturing Engineering is the 447th most popular major in the country with 966 degrees awarded in 2019-2020.

Across New Jersey, there were 5 general manufacturing eng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 5 general manufacturing eng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$60,690 and $39,821 respectively.

New Jersey Institute of Technology is a public institution located in Newark, New Jersey. The school has a fairly large population, and it awarded 5 masters’s degrees in 2019-2020.

In addition to being on our new jersey master’s degree general manufacturing engineering students whose families make more than $110k list, NJIT has also earned the #1 rank in our “Best General Manufacturing Engineering Master’s Degree Schools in New Jersey” ranking. Average graduate tuition and fees at NJIT are $33,744, but you may pay more or less depending on your major.
